Anyone on the list used this product? https://www.keelguard.com/shop/ I do a lot of solo touring and inspite of best efforts the two or three feet of my keel near the stern takes a beating on landings. I'd thought about one of the brass keelstrips that canoeists use, but can't figure out a way to install it that wouldn't leave sharp screwheads pointing up way back in the stern compartment where I can't cover them. I was thinking four feet or so of Keelguard might do the trick. If anyone has experience of it, could they comment on ease or difficulty of installation and effect (if any) on speed?
